  • Patent number: 9634595
    Abstract: The present disclosure relates to a method and a generator system for operating a generator. The method for operating the generator includes exciting the field winding of a rotor of the generator by a first exciter device, driving a second exciter device while operating the generator with the first exciter device, and switching the second exciter device to excite the generator in case the first exciter device feeds to the generator not sufficient energy for operating the generator during a malfunction of the first exciter device. Further, a corresponding generator system is described.

  • Patent number: 8479943
    Abstract: A sheet-material piercer (1) for a container closure (2) of the push-pull type is of essentially rotationally symmetrical design and can be inserted into the container closure (2) in the direction of the axis of rotation of symmetry (R) such that it can be displaced axially independently of the push-pull part of the container closure (2). The sheet-material piercer (1) is in one piece and has at least one sealing formation (16, 17, 18) which is likewise of rotationally symmetrical design and is arranged between an actuating end (13) and a piercing end (14). The sealing formation (16, 17, 18) is designed for sealing and latching contact with the container closure (2). Also proposed is a container closure (2) for a container (3) with a so-called push-pull closure and such a sheet-material piercer (1).

  • Publication number: 20080067172
    Abstract: The invention relates to a “push-pull” type closure (2) for a container comprising a cover part (1) which can be placed about a container opening and which comprises a sealing lip (4), and a sliding part (6) which is applied in a displaceable manner to the cover part (1). An outflow opening (5) can be opened or closed by displacing the sliding part (6) on the cover part (1). A splitable or piercable closure film (77) is applied to the sealing lip (4), whereby an additional chamber (8) which is divided in a sealed manner in relation to the contents of the container, is formed the inner chamber of the cover part (1) which is oriented towards the sliding part (6). A pin (9) is applied in a displaceable manner to the cover part (1) and comprises a tearing and piercing device (10). The closure film (7) can be torn open or pierced when the pin (9) is actuated and a substance or active substance can be added to the additional chamber (8) which can also penetrate into the container.

  • Patent number: 5346048
    Abstract: An apparatus for collecting articles is housed in a parallelepipedic casing, on the front panel of which is arranged a display part of a playing part. An article-return part with an article-receiving container is also provided in the apparatus. The front panel of the casing is subdivided into a number of fields of which one field forms a door for an access to an article collecting container. A gaming machine is arranged in another field, and the article-return part in the third field. The gaming machine is at least partly visible through a window so that its game can be seen. Increased use of the apparatus results from the visibility and/or audibility of the game.

  • Patent number: 4094323
    Abstract: The method of making expanded and fiberized tobacco stem and stalk materials having increased filling capacity and suitable for use as filler in smoking articles comprising conditioning said stem material by adjusting the moisture content to a level of at least about 10% to about 50% by weight while maintained at a temperature of about 115.degree. to 170.degree. C. and a pressure of about 10 to 100 psig for a period of from about 0.1 to 5 minutes and mechanically fiberizing the thus treated stem material while it is under a pressure of about 10 to 100 psig between fiberizing surfaces maintained from about 0.05 to 0.3 inch apart. The invention also includes smoking articles made from such expanded stem material having increased filling capacity and lowered "tar" and nicotine.
